Description Miro Hrončok 2020-06-30 18:35:28 UTC
Spec URL: https://churchyard.fedorapeople.org/SRPMS/epel-release.spec
SRPM URL: https://churchyard.fedorapeople.org/SRPMS/epel-release-8-9.fc33.src.rpm

Description:
This package contains the Extra Packages for Enterprise Linux (EPEL)
repository GPG key as well as configuration for yum.

Fedora Account System Username: churchyard

This package is retired in Fedora, see https://src.fedoraproject.org/rpms/epel-release/pull-request/9 with individual commits.
